


Perbezaan antara bahagian hadapan web dan bahagian hadapan enjin
Dengan perkembangan pesat Internet dan peranti mudah alih, pembangunan bahagian hadapan telah menjadi salah satu bidang paling popular dalam teknologi maklumat moden. Antaranya, Web front-end dan enjin front-end adalah konsep yang agak biasa dalam medan front-end. Walaupun kedua-duanya tergolong dalam pembangunan bahagian hadapan, terdapat perbezaan tertentu di antara mereka. Dalam artikel ini, kami akan menganalisis dan membandingkan perbezaan antara bahagian hadapan web dan bahagian hadapan enjin.
1. Pengenalan kepada bahagian hadapan Web
Halaman hadapan web merujuk kepada bahagian antara muka pengguna untuk membuat tapak web. Ia terutamanya termasuk HTML, CSS, JavaScript, rangka kerja bahagian hadapan, perpustakaan dan teknologi lain. Tanggungjawab utama bahagian hadapan Web adalah untuk mereka bentuk dan membangunkan halaman Web, aplikasi Web dan aplikasi Web untuk membantu pengguna memaparkan dan mengendalikan data dengan lebih baik.
Reka bentuk hadapan dan pembangunan tapak web adalah tugas yang sangat penting, yang mempengaruhi pengalaman pengguna dan trafik tapak web. Oleh itu, pembangunan bahagian hadapan Web perlu memberi tumpuan kepada pengalaman pengguna Sambil mengekalkan keindahan dan interaktiviti halaman, ia juga perlu untuk mempertimbangkan prestasi keseluruhan tapak web. Pembangunan bahagian hadapan web memerlukan kemahiran dalam HTML, CSS, JavaScript dan teknologi lain, serta memahami penggunaan dan teknik pengoptimuman pelbagai rangka kerja bahagian hadapan.
2. Pengenalan kepada bahagian hadapan enjin
Bahagian hadapan enjin merujuk kepada enjin yang digunakan untuk memaparkan halaman dalam pelayar web. Ia boleh dikatakan bahawa bahagian hadapan enjin adalah asas kepada bahagian hadapan Web. Bahagian hadapan enjin biasanya merupakan penyepaduan set modul berbeza seperti enjin JavaScript, enjin pemaparan teks, enjin pemaparan GPU dan enjin rangkaian. Tanggungjawab utama bahagian hadapan enjin adalah untuk menghuraikan dan memaparkan kandungan halaman seperti HTML, CSS dan JavaScript, dan memaparkannya pada skrin mengikut reka letak dan gaya yang diberikan.
Enjin bahagian hadapan ialah asas kepada bahagian hadapan Web, dan prestasi serta fungsinya mempunyai kesan penting pada paparan halaman Web. Oleh itu, pembangunan bahagian hadapan enjin perlu memberi tumpuan kepada prestasi dan kesan pemaparan halaman, dan juga perlu memastikan keserasian dengan pelbagai piawaian dan protokol.
3. Perbezaan antara bahagian hadapan Web dan bahagian hadapan enjin
- Skop teknikal yang berbeza
Halaman hadapan web tertumpu terutamanya pada tapak web pembangunan, memfokuskan pada aplikasi teknologi hadapan dan pengoptimuman. Bahagian hadapan enjin ialah asas bahagian hadapan Web, terutamanya memfokuskan pada pembangunan dan pengoptimuman enjin penyemak imbas.
- Kesukaran teknikal yang berbeza
Web front-end agak mudah dan mudah dipelajari oleh pemula, tetapi ia memerlukan pemahaman yang mendalam tentang pelbagai teknologi front-end untuk membangunkan aplikasi Web berkualiti tinggi. Bahagian hadapan enjin memerlukan latar belakang teknikal yang kukuh dan keupayaan pengaturcaraan yang kukuh, kerana ia perlu menyelesaikan banyak masalah pelaksanaan teknologi yang mendasari.
- Matlamat yang berbeza
Matlamat bahagian hadapan Web adalah untuk mereka bentuk bahagian hadapan tapak web menjadi antara muka yang cekap, cantik dan mudah digunakan untuk memberikan pengalaman pengguna yang lebih baik. Matlamat bahagian hadapan enjin adalah untuk menyediakan enjin pelayar yang stabil, cekap dan mematuhi piawaian untuk membantu pembangun bahagian hadapan Web memaparkan halaman Web dengan lebih baik.
4. Kesimpulan
Walaupun bahagian hadapan Web dan bahagian hadapan enjin adalah kedua-dua teknologi bahagian hadapan, ia berbeza dari segi skop teknikal, kesukaran teknikal dan matlamat. Bahagian hadapan web memfokuskan pada pembangunan halaman web dan pengalaman pengguna, manakala bahagian hadapan enjin tertumpu terutamanya pada pembangunan dan pengoptimuman enjin penyemak imbas. Bagi pembangun bahagian hadapan, mahir dalam teknologi bahagian hadapan Web dan bahagian hadapan enjin akan membantu meningkatkan tahap pembangunan dan keupayaan profesional mereka, dan juga menjadikan pembangunan bahagian hadapan lebih cekap dan inovatif.
Atas ialah kandungan terperinci Perbezaan antara bahagian hadapan web dan bahagian hadapan enjin.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Alat AI Hot

Undresser.AI Undress
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over
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ool
Gambar buka pakaian secara percuma

Clothoff.io
Penyingkiran pakaian AI

AI Hentai Generator
Menjana ai hentai secara percuma.

Artikel Panas

Alat panas

Notepad++7.3.1
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ina
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1
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6
Alat pembangunan web visual

SublimeText3 versi Mac
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Topik panas



Artikel ini membincangkan useeffect dalam React, cangkuk untuk menguruskan kesan sampingan seperti pengambilan data dan manipulasi DOM dalam komponen berfungsi. Ia menerangkan penggunaan, kesan sampingan yang biasa, dan pembersihan untuk mencegah masalah seperti kebocoran memori.

Lazy memuatkan kelewatan memuatkan kandungan sehingga diperlukan, meningkatkan prestasi web dan pengalaman pengguna dengan mengurangkan masa beban awal dan beban pelayan.

Artikel ini menerangkan algoritma perdamaian React, yang dengan cekap mengemas kini DOM dengan membandingkan pokok DOM maya. Ia membincangkan manfaat prestasi, teknik pengoptimuman, dan kesan terhadap pengalaman pengguna. Kira -kira: 159

Artikel ini membincangkan kari dalam JavaScript, teknik yang mengubah fungsi multi-argumen ke dalam urutan fungsi argumen tunggal. Ia meneroka pelaksanaan kari, faedah seperti aplikasi separa, dan kegunaan praktikal, meningkatkan kod baca

Fungsi pesanan yang lebih tinggi dalam JavaScript meningkatkan ketabahan kod, kebolehgunaan semula, modulariti, dan prestasi melalui abstraksi, corak umum, dan teknik pengoptimuman.

Artikel ini menerangkan USEContext dalam React, yang memudahkan pengurusan negara dengan mengelakkan penggerudian prop. Ia membincangkan faedah seperti keadaan terpusat dan penambahbaikan prestasi melalui pengurangan semula yang dikurangkan.

Artikel membincangkan penyambungan komponen reaksi ke kedai redux menggunakan Connect (), menerangkan MapStateToprops, MapdispatchToprops, dan kesan prestasi.

Artikel membincangkan menghalang tingkah laku lalai dalam pengendali acara menggunakan kaedah pencegahanDefault (), faedahnya seperti pengalaman pengguna yang dipertingkatkan, dan isu -isu yang berpotensi seperti kebimbangan aksesibiliti.
